Five Meetings On the Docket for Tuesday
Here are five things to start your Tuesday in Reading.
1. Happening Tuesday: There are several meetings slated for Tuesday in Reading. At 3 p.m. the School Council meets, at 6 p.m. the Board of Cemetery Trustees is in action, the Board of Selectmen holds a 7 p.m. session while the Recreation Committee and Board of Assessors meet at 7 p.m. as well.
2. Rockets in Action: The Reading High School field hockey team hosts Melrose on Tuesday beginning at 3:30 p.m. The boys and girls cross country track teams are also in action on Tuesday, racing against Winchester at 3:45 p.m. out of town.
3. Sunny Tuesday: After a windy start to the week, things will calm down a bit on Tuesday. According to the National Weather Service, temperatures will peak at 66 degrees and skies will be sunny to go with a northwest wind of 7 to 13 MPH.
4. Playoff Baseball: The Boston Red Sox suffered a heartbreaking walk-off loss on Monday night in Tampa Bay as the Rays pulled their American League Division Series within striking distance as the series is now 2-1 in favor of Boston. On Tuesday night the teams play again at Tropicana Field as the Red Sox hope to move on to the American League Championship Series.
